CTP Lahore Announces Heavy Fine to Citizens Without Driving License

The City Traffic Police (CTP) Lahore has announced a heavy fine to citizens without driving license from 6 December 2021 on the directives of the Lahore High Court (LHC).

According to the details, the citizens driving without a driving license will have to pay a fine of Rs. 2,000 on the directives of Lahore High Court (LHC). The decision was announced by Justice Shahid Karim in response to several petitions in the matter.

In other news, the National Highway and Motorway Police (NHMP) has banned the entry of all vehicles without M-Tag on M-2 Motorway (Lahore to Islamabad) from 7 December 2021 on the directives on the Lahore High Court (LHC).
